As stated on MLA.org: All fields of research agree on the need to document scholarly borrowings, but documentation conventions vary because of the different needs of scholarly disciplines. MLA style for documentation is widely used in the humanities, especially in writing on language and literature.

Although publishers vary in how they style epigraphs, one commonality is that epigraphs are set apart from the main text by being placed at the start of a book, chapter, essay, or other section of a work. They usually do not appear in quotation marks. Sometimes, they are italicized or set in a font different from that used in the text.

To create an in-text MLA citation, you typically include the author’s last name and the page number of the work being cited in parentheses right after the reference. The citation’s contents will change a little depending on factors like multiple authors and if a source is audiovisual or online, but they'll all follow the same general format.

MLA format follows the author-page method of in-text citation. This means that the author's last name and the page number (s) from which the quotation or paraphrase is taken must appear in the text, and a complete reference should appear on your Works Cited page. To set up MLA in Google Docs using this template: Open a new document and select File > New > From template . The template gallery will open in a separate browser tab. Scroll down to the Education section and select Report MLA Add-on . There are also templates for other academic styles such as APA.

With its user-friendly interface and powerful features, it has become a... Begin your Works Cited page on a separate page at the end of your research paper. It should have the same one-inch margins and last name, page number header as the rest of your paper. Label the page Works Cited (do not italicize the words Works Cited or put them in quotation marks) and center the words Works Cited at the top of the page. If you’re writing your paper in Microsoft Word, follow these steps: Click Insert. Scroll down to Page Numbers and click on it. Set the position to “Top of Page (Header)”. Set the alignment to “Right”. Make sure there’s no checkmark in the box for “Show number on first page”. flip z 5apps like zip MLA Formatting for Word - Online Version.
